Tamil Nadu, a southern Indian state, offers a rich tapestry of history, culture, and natural beauty. While popular destinations like Chennai, Madurai, and Mahabalipuram are must-visits, there are hidden gems that promise an unforgettable family experience. Here are some off-the-beaten-path destinations in Tamil Nadu:
1. Thanjavur: The City of Temples
- Brihadisvara Temple: This UNESCO World Heritage Site is a marvel of Chola architecture. Its towering gopuram and intricate carvings are a sight to behold.
- Thanjavur Palace: Explore the grandeur of this 17th-century palace, which now houses a museum showcasing the region’s history and culture.
- Keezhaperumpudur: Take a short drive to this village to witness the beautiful Thanjavur painting tradition.
2. Yercaud: The Hill Station with a Twist
- Emerald Lake: Enjoy a leisurely boat ride on this serene lake surrounded by lush greenery.
- Shevaroy Hills: Hike through these hills for breathtaking panoramic views of the surrounding landscape.
- Lady’s Seat: Take a romantic stroll to this viewpoint for stunning sunset vistas.
3. Kodaikanal: The Queen of Hills
- Coaker’s Walk: Enjoy a leisurely walk along this scenic promenade with panoramic views of the valley.
- Kodaikanal Lake: Rent a boat and explore this picturesque lake, surrounded by lush forests.
- Bryant Park: Relax amidst the beautiful botanical gardens and enjoy a picnic.
4. Rameswaram: The Holy Island
- Ramanathaswamy Temple: Visit this sacred Hindu temple, one of the 12 Jyotirlingas in India.
- Pamban Bridge: Marvel at this iconic railway bridge connecting Rameswaram to the mainland.
- Dhanushkodi: Explore the ghost town of Dhanushkodi, devastated by the 1964 cyclone.
